Synopsis by Violet LeVoit
When a lonely young man (Cameron Pazirandeh) learns that he will die in 14 days, he begins filming a video diary that will document his experiences facing death and give his empty life some meaning. This variation on a found-footage movie was written and directed by Pazirandeh, who shot it on a miniscule budget with an iPhone SE and a MacBook Pro webcam.
